Drying stress of yttria-stabilized-zirconia slurry on a metal substrate

Aqueous yttria-stabilized-zirconia (YSZ) nano-particle slurries (termed as nano-slurries later) were cast on metal substrates to form wet coatings. Stress development was measured using a substrate reflection method, coupled with drying kinetics measurements and coating structure examination. Lateral drying occurred and was controlled by the viscosity of the slurry. Tensile stress was generated due to constrained shrinkage of the wet coating when the slurry became saturated with water, starting from the coating edge when the solid concentration reached a certain level. As the saturated region extended to the centre, the stress increased to the maximum, then dropped quickly to zero due to cracking and delamination. Addition of micro-sized particles to the nano-slurry resulted in reduction of the peak stress while no apparent cracks were formed during drying. In addition, non-zero residual stress remained after drying, suggesting good bonding between the coating and the substrate.
